Variant summary

Our verdict is Uncertain significance. Variant got 2 ACMG points: 2P and 0B. PM2

The ENST00000241436.9(POLK):c.1291C>A(p.Gln431Lys) variant causes a missense change involving the alteration of a conserved nucleotide. The variant allele was found at a frequency of 0.00000827 in 1,451,588 control chromosomes in the GnomAD database, with no homozygous occurrence.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
POLK (HGNC:9183): (DNA polymerase kappa) This gene encodes a member of the DNA polymerase type-Y family of proteins. The encoded protein is a specialized DNA polymerase that catalyzes translesion DNA synthesis, which allows DNA replication in the presence of DNA lesions. Human cell lines lacking a functional copy of this gene exhibit impaired genome integrity and enhanced susceptibility to oxidative damage. Mutations in this gene that impair enzyme activity may be associated with prostate cancer in human patients. [provided by RefSeq, Sep 2016]

Uncertain significance, criteria provided, single submitterclinical testingAmbry GeneticsMay 31, 2023The c.1291C>A (p.Q431K) alteration is located in exon 11 (coding exon 10) of the POLK gene. This alteration results from a C to A substitution at nucleotide position 1291, causing the glutamine (Q) at amino acid position 431 to be replaced by a lysine (K).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
